Contract Role - Client Services Representative (Investment Services) - Contact Centre - Manchester/Hybrid - 12 months initial - Inside IR35

Role Overview:

  • Location: Hybrid - 4 days onsite per week in Manchester
  • Weekly rotating shifts between 8:30am and 6:00pm
  • Contract Duration: 12 months initial
  • Rate: £25.11 per hour (inclusive of holiday pay)

Key Responsibilities:

  • Act as the primary point of contact for shareholder enquiries across phone, email, web chat, and written correspondence. The role is predominantly phone based, with time split between live client interaction and independent case investigation.
  • Deliver a consistently high quality service in a fast paced environment, managing client conversations confidently while working to demanding productivity and quality targets.
  • Execute telephone trades accurately and efficiently, strictly in line with client instructions, regulatory requirements, and documented procedures.
  • Handle both straightforward and complex shareholder queries, providing clear, confident technical support and taking ownership of issues through to resolution.
  • Investigate discrepancies and errors on shareholder accounts and statements, applying sound judgement, attention to detail, and structured problem solving.
